I had already picked up a b6t motor and trans from a 1992 Capri. That was destined for my Festiva. Since the 323 has a HORRIBLE rod knock, the engine is actually going into the 323. A few weeks ago I had a guy offer to sell me his Capri with a b6t running and driving for $500. It is in poor shape and not worth saving as a complete car, so it is being swapped into the Festiva. Will likely be keeping both cars for now as I have all the parts, just need some weather and time. In the end I will have a spare b6t to rebuild as well as a spare Capri trans.
